Twins receive 40 college acceptances from 15 different states, N288m in scholarship

- Twins have received a whopping 40 college acceptance letters

- The colleges are spread across 15 different states

- These two lucky teens have also received scholarships of over N288 million

Twins take to social media to celebrate with the world after they received a staggering 40 college acceptance letters from 15 different states combined.

Akhya and Akhea Mitchell went to Troup County Comprehensive High School in LaGrange, Georgia, and reportedly earned a 4.5 GPA and 3.9 GPA respectively.

According to their viral Facebook post, the acceptances have also come with scholarships of over N288 million (about US$900,000).
It was probably not easy choosing which university to go to, as most of the 40 colleges that want to see them in their campuses are said to be highly placed in the global league table.

However, the twins have decided to go to Howard University.

Diddy is 2017's highest paid musician despite not releasing any new music. Beyonce comes in 2nd with $105m

Talk about being a boss! Forbes has released its annual list of the highest paid musicians for the year 2017 and Diddy is the highest paid even though he hasn't released any new music. Infact the top 4 highest paid musicians of 2017 were black artists. After Diddy, Beyonce ranks second, followed by Drake. Sean "Diddy" Combs made $130 million in earnings over the past 12 months. Forbes reports that there are three reasons behind the rapper and mogul’s climb. He sold one-third of his Sean John clothing line for an estimated $70 million, he has his lucrative Diageo Ciroc vodka partnership, and he put on his Bad Boy Family Reunion Tour. Diddy wasn’t on last year’s list, which was topped by Taylor Swift. Swift fell from the top spot to No. 49 with $44 million earned over the past year. "This is taking an awful long time": Last words of scientist, 104, as he dies in Swiss suicide clinic after opting for euthanasia

The British scientist who regretted living to 104 years and opted for euthanasia, has died in a Swiss clinic surrounded by family and the sound of Beethoven's 9th Symphony. Dr David Goodall's last words just before he was injected with a lethal dose of a sleeping drug was, "This is taking an awful long time." He died at the Swiss suicide clinic at 11.30am on Thursday morning, medical staff at the facility in Liestal, near Basel, Switzerland, confirmed. The world-renowned botanist died within two minutes of being injected. Six family members wept by his bedside and, in accordance with his final wishes, Beethoven's Ode to Joy played on an iPad.
